What is the greatest insight you've gained from the experience running the initiative? That the communities will always surprise you, and teach you something, provided you are willing to be present with them and listen. Are there any particular moments with travelers or partner communities that stand out to you? Recently, a group from Malaysia wanted to donate money to one of the entrepreneurs we introduced them to at the GK Enchanted Farm. However, the entrepreneur herself amazed our guests by saying that she would rather the money went to someone else who needed it even more than her. That is the spirit of walang iwanan (no one left behind)! What would you like your travelers to gain or take away from a trip with MAD Travel? Through the power of presence it really is possible to change the world, one community at a time, and that if we are able to redefine travel as a search for meaning and greater understanding of the world around us, then change can come more quicker than you imagine. How have your partner communities responded to the initiative? They have really bought into the concept and now regularly look forward to the next time we will be bringing guests. We needed to show that we are willing to be present in the communities on a regular basis, week-in week-out, and prove that we are not just another outside organization bringing empty promises.
